-
Notifications
You must be signed in to change notification settings - Fork 33
/
Copy pathpackage.json
36 lines (36 loc) · 1.63 KB
/
package.json
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
{
"name": "@nrk/yr-weather-symbols",
"version": "14.0.0",
"description": "Yr weather symbols",
"author": "[email protected], Simen Sægrov <[email protected]>",
"types": "dist/index.d.ts",
"main": "dist/index.js",
"scripts": {
"clean": "rimraf dist/* docs/*",
"build": "npm run clean && npm run build:symbols && npm run build:typescript && npm run build:copy-locales && npm run build:docs",
"prebuild:symbols": "docker build --build-arg SRC_FOLDER=symbols --build-arg SCRIPT_FOLDER=bin --build-arg NPM_TOKEN=${NPM_TOKEN} --tag yr-weather-symbols-1 .",
"build:symbols": "docker run -v $PWD/dist:/dist --cap-add=SYS_ADMIN --rm yr-weather-symbols-1",
"build:typescript": "tsc",
"build:copy-locales": "cpy locales/* dist/locales",
"build:docs": "npm run build:docs:build && npm run build:docs:copy-symbols && npm run build:docs:zip-symbols",
"build:docs:build": "tsc --resolveJsonModule bin/buildDocs.ts && node bin/buildDocs.js",
"build:docs:copy-symbols": "cpy dist/symbols/lightmode/svg docs/symbols/lightmode && cpy dist/symbols/darkmode/svg docs/symbols/darkmode && cpy dist/symbols/shadows/svg docs/symbols/shadows",
"build:docs:zip-symbols": "zip -r docs/symbols.zip dist/symbols",
"prepublishOnly": "npm run build",
"publish:docs": "gh-pages --dist docs"
},
"repository": "https://github.com/nrkno/yr-weather-symbols/",
"license": "MIT",
"dependencies": {},
"devDependencies": {
"@nrk/yr-convert-graphics": "^1.1.0",
"@types/node": "^14.14.37",
"cpy-cli": "^3.1.1",
"gh-pages": "^3.1.0",
"rimraf": "^3.0.2",
"typescript": "^4.2.3"
},
"files": [
"dist"
]
}